[Stone & Kimball Rarity in Original Printed Wrappers] The Picture Book of Becky Sharp. A Play in Four Acts Founded on Thackeray's "Vanity Fair"

Chicago: Herbert S. Stone & Co., 1899.

First edition. Folio. Original publishers gray card wrappers with design and cover stamped in red. Photographic frontispiece (also pictured in smaller format on half-title), rubricated title page, and photographic illustrations throughout. Scarce Stone imprint, this curiosity has the complete text of a rather obscure play by Langdon Mitchell, illustrated with photographs of the actors both posed and in action by Byron and Sarony, along with drawings accompanying the text. Not listed in Publisher's Weekly until April, 1900. Corners only very slightly worn, very unobtrusive water marks to preliminary leaves, else a near fine copy of an exceedingly scarce and interesting Stone imprint. Our Kramer bibliography, owned by Bob Monroe, one of the foremost collectors of Stone and Kimball, has it as one of the rarest Stone titles. Near fine with minimal chipping to cover wrappers.
